The King of the Desert: How "Crazy Handful of Nothin'" Forged Heisenberg
If Breaking Bad began as the tragic story of a desperate man, Season 1, Episode 6, "Crazy Handful of Nothin'," is the moment the tragedy morphs into a thriller. It is the fulcrum of the first season—the episode where Walter White stops running from his problems and starts attacking them.
